折騰了2個小時,參考了網上的資料,終於把QT裝好了
要讓qt能使用,兩種套路都可行:
1、安裝傻瓜包QtSDK,大概1GB多,
你要用到的所有東西都在這里面,按照默認的安裝,
裝好后直接打開qt creator就可以用。
2、自己組裝:
(1)下載Qt Creator (qt-creator-win-opensource-2.4.1.exe),就是你下載的50多MB的那個,按照默認的裝上;
(2)下載Qt Framework (qt-win-opensource-4.8.0-mingw.exe),兩三百兆的,
按照默認的裝上。
打開qt creator,菜單“工具”--》“選項”,
在打開的對話框里選左邊的“構建和運行”,
右邊選“Qt版本”,
點擊添加,找到你之前安裝的Qt Framework 的文件夾里的bin子文件夾,
找到qmake.exe,然后點擊確定,這樣就設置好了,
就能解決你遇到的“找不到合適的QT版本”的問題。
下面說這些工具的關系:
要正常使用qt,至少要這些東西:可以到http://qt-project.org/downloads網址下載
(1)代碼編寫和調試的界面,就是qt creator
(2)代碼編譯工具合集,如MinGW(包括gcc和g++、gdb等)
(3)Qt庫本身,包括頭文件、庫文件和qt designer設計師、qt assitant幫助、qt linguist翻譯器三個工具。
qt官方是這樣打包的:
上面(1)(2)部分打包一起的,如qt-creator-win-opensource-2.4.1.exe,(注意2.5版本以后沒有提供打包、需要你自己下載MinGW-gcc440_1.zip
在安裝過程中會提示你需要的編譯器版本)把這里面的都裝上,就有了代碼編輯和編譯的兩部分工具。
上面(3)部分打包在Qt Framework 里面,如qt-win-opensource-4.8.0-mingw.exe
。
安裝步驟:
1、順序先安裝qt creator這個跟后面兩個無關自定義目錄安裝即可。
2、自定義位置安裝MinGW。MinGW和qt-win-opensource-4.8.0-mingw.exe必須先安裝前者,因為在安裝qt-win-opensource-4.8.0-mingw.exe時必須指定編譯庫位置
3、安裝qt-win-opensource-4.8.0-mingw.exe在安裝過程中需要指定MinGW安裝目錄位置。
4、三個都安裝完畢后,運行qt creator 在工具->選項->QT版本->選擇添加找到之前安裝的qt-win-opensource-4.8.0-mingw.exe的文件夾里的bin子文件夾->應用
而qt SDK是1GB多的大包,包括上面提到的(1)(2)(3)全部的東西,
裝上Qt SDK就什么都有了。